Job description

We are seeking a motivated Qualified Person (Risk Assessment) to join our team as an Environmental Risk Assessment Specialist. The successful candidate will have a QPRA designation and a university degree in a relevant science or engineering discipline. This position requires a minimum of 5 years experience in human health and ecological risk assessments brownfield remediation and risk management measures or a related field. The successful candidate will complete risk assessments under . 153/04 guidance. Experience with nuclear risk assessments (dose assessment safety regulatory compliance etc.) is not required but considered an asset.

  • Lead design and conduct Human Health Risk Assessments (HHRA) and Ecological Risk Assessments (ERA) for major transportation projects (i.e. Hamilton LRT Pearson Airport) infrastructure developments and contaminated sites sectors;
  • Apply and interpret O. Reg. 153/04 requirements including MGRAs vapour intrusion assessments development of risk management measures;
  • Produce high-quality technical work provide constructive feedback and support staff skill development;
  • Support proposal writing project scoping and client relationship development;
  • Be an emerging leader in the risk assessment community;
  • Contribute to development and implementation of risk assessment strategy with other team members to grow the business; and
  • Work with other innovative thinkers to cultivate business development opportunities.

Qualifications :

  • Qualified Person for Risk Assessment (QPRA) in Ontario required
  • Bachelors Degree in relevant discipline
  • 8 years experience in human health and ecological risk assessments brownfield remediation and risk management measures or a related field;
  • Accomplished at using spreadsheets (or equivalent) to coalesce and evaluate complex datasets and develop exposure models;
  • Effective communication skills (verbal and written);
  • Excellent analytical skills;
  • Excellent organizational skills including attention to detail; and
  • Experience training and mentoring staff on projects.
